Where it came from
My father-in-law had dementia. I wanted him to be able to pick up his phone, say "Hey Entee", and ask what he was doing today — and get a gentle, clear answer. He wanted to know the weather and what to wear, how his shares were performing, what he did yesterday, and what time to take his pills. I wanted him to be able to ask any question — at 2am, on a Sunday — and get a calm, patient response every single time, as many times as he needed, without bothering anyone.
I couldn't find that. So I built it.
Then I kept using it myself. On the drive home to unwind. To build a speech across a dozen conversations. To remember things I'd never have written down. To ask questions and actually get answers — instantly, without searching. I realised I'd built something that anyone with a busy mind would find useful — not just carers, not just families, but anyone who needs a patient, private companion that remembers everything and knows everything.
What it is
Entee is a voice-first AI companion built on long-term memory. It listens. It remembers. It searches. It answers — in plain, calm language, whenever you need it.
Most AI assistants forget you the moment you close the app. Every conversation starts from scratch. Entee is different. It remembers everything across sessions, across days, across months — your people, your routines, your conversations, your questions. The longer you use Entee, the more it understands you, and the more useful it becomes.
And when you ask something it doesn't already know about you, it goes and finds the answer. Entee is connected to the live web — so no question is too current, too obscure, or too random. Just ask.

What it does
Once the app is open, say "Hey Entee" and Entee responds:
- Answers any question, any time — out loud, immediately, without needing to type a word.
- Searches the web in real time — connected to live information via Sonar so no question is out of reach, too current, or too obscure. The weather, the news, a medication, the footy score — just ask.
- Remembers everything you tell it — names, notes, routines, appointments, ideas, conversations — building a long-term memory that grows with you across days, weeks, and months.
- Knows you better over time — the longer you use Entee, the more it understands your world. Your people, your routines, what matters most. That knowledge is yours — private, secure, and deleted the moment you ask.
- Works in your car via Apple CarPlay — talk on the drive home, dictate a speech, think through a problem completely hands-free.
- Supports people living with dementia — a calm, patient companion they can talk to directly, in their own words, any time of day or night.
- Supports carers and families — remembers what matters so you don't have to carry it alone.
- Tracks your portfolio — ask plain questions about your investments while you make coffee.
- Captures your thinking — building a speech, working through a decision, or just needing somewhere to put your thoughts.
